USAGE
USAGE
Terracotta tiles are sealed, making them a suitable for:
INTERIOR
- Interior flooring (may require additional sealing, maintenance, can patina, darken or stain on floors, if left untreated)
- Heated flooring systems (e.g., Ditra system)
- Mudrooms, Laundry, Entryway
- Kitchen backsplashes / island
- Bathroom floors (may require additional sealing, maintenance, can patina, darken or stain on floors, if left untreated)
- Fireplaces (surround)
- Decorative walls
- Commercial vertical surfaces (ie. restaurants, bars, retail stores, and offices)
- Stair risers
EXTERIOR (Requires waterproofing, sealing and maintenance)
- Exterior flooring (patios and porches in temperate climates)
- Outdoor kitchens (mild climates)
- Most exterior areas not directly exposed to harsh or frequent freezing
Avoid use in these areas:
- Areas exposed to harsh or frequent freezing temperatures
- Commercial kitchens (floors or walls - does not apply to residential)
- Steam rooms
- Shower walls and floors
- Frequently wet areas

HOW IT'S MADE
Saltillo tiles originate from Saltillo, Coahuila in northwest Mexico. Just as Champagne must be produced in the Champagne region of France, authentic Saltillo tiles must come from this specific Mexican region.
Clay is sourced from the surrounding area to produce Natural Terracotta tiles. The manufacturing process is carried out by generations of skilled craftsmen who take pride in their tradition.
GROUT
TYPE
We recommend Mapei Natural Saltillo grout for Natural Terracotta tiles.
JOINTS
Saltillo tile joint spacing can be as wide as 3/4” and as narrow as 1/4”. Generally, smaller joint sizes are used with smaller tiles (6” and under) and tend to look more modern.
Larger joints are used with larger format tiles to accommodate for irregular sizing of handmade tiles while maintaining straight joints and their traditional aesthetic.

PRE-SEALED FOR EASY INSTALLATION
PRE-SEALED
Matte-sealed terracotta tiles are delivered with a factory-applied pre-seal to simplify installation and grouting. This pre-seal is intended as a starting point, not a final protective layer.
To maintain the appearance and performance of the tile, a topcoat sealer must be applied after installation, and periodically thereafter depending on use.
For optimal stain resistance and easier maintenance, we recommend applying our Ultra Low VOC sealer as a topcoat. This surface-forming sealer offers significantly more protection than penetrating sealers alone and is ideal for kitchens, bathrooms, entryways, and other active spaces. It adds a very subtle low sheen and may slightly deepen the color.
For vertical or low-contact surfaces where a fully matte look is preferred, our Penetrating Sealer (matte finish) may be used, with the understanding that stain resistance will be more limited.
Why a topcoat matters
- Provides substantially greater stain resistance than factory or penetrating sealers alone
- Seals both tile and grout for more consistent protection
- Improves durability and performance in real-world residential use
- Top coat sealers are different from the factory sealant and offers an extra layer of protection, by enhance their durability especially for high traffic areas.
RESEALING FREQUENCY
The timing for resealing can vary based on several factors, including the level of foot traffic, aesthetic preferences, and the overall usage. There isn’t a fixed timeline for resealing; it depends on the specific circumstances of your space.
Some choose to reseal after 1 year, 3 years, 5 years, or decide to forgo resealing altogether. To check if it’s time for resealing, look for signs such as noticeable changes in color or water no longer beading on the surface. If liquid absorbs instead of repels, it's a good indicator that resealing is recommended. Ultimately, the decision to reseal is tailored to each project and reflects individual preferences.
MAINTENANCE
Regular maintenance is essential for preserving the beauty and longevity of handmade terracotta tile.
For routine cleaning, sweep or vacuum regularly to remove dirt and debris. For deeper cleaning, use a damp mop with warm water and a pH-neutral cleaner such as our Palo Santo Cleaner Concentrate.
Important maintenance notes
- Avoid bleach, ammonia, acidic cleaners, or degreasers, as these can damage sealers and discolor terracotta.
- Dish soaps may leave residues that attract dirt and should not be used for regular cleaning.
- Always rinse thoroughly and allow the surface to dry completely.
Addressing stains
Matte terracotta can absorb oils and moisture if not fully protected. For stubborn stains, a stone-safe poultice or slightly more abrasive cleaner may be used after testing in an inconspicuous area. Persistent staining typically indicates the need for a more protective topcoat sealer.
Preventative care
- Wipe spills promptly, especially oils and liquids
- Use rugs or mats in high-traffic or moisture-prone areas
- Reapply protective sealer periodically based on wear and use
For those seeking the most practical, low-maintenance experience, we strongly recommend sealing with Ultra Low VOC Sealant from the start.
SHEEN | SEALANT
MATTE SEALED
Matte pre-sealed terracotta preserves the most natural color and character of terracotta, but it does not provide the highest level of stain protection.
These tiles are factory sealed to offer basic water resistance. However, because terracotta is inherently porous, matte sealed tiles can still absorb oils, moisture, and everyday contaminants, even when a penetrating sealer is used. In high-traffic or moisture-prone areas, natural darkening and patina should be expected over time. For most applications, additional sealing after installation is strongly recommended.
First, our Ultra Low VOC Sealant (semi-gloss finish) can be used. For vertical surfaces, we recommend using our Penetrating Sealant (matte finish) for stain protection.

TEXTURE
NATURAL VARIATIONS
Unique variations are telltale signs of Saltillo tiles, which are exclusive to authentic tiles, like ours.
It’s normal to find slight indentations, bumps, divots, scuffs, and even the occasional paw print on the surface of our tiles. You may find excess clay or minor chips around the edges or on the back of the tiles, as well as marks or lines. All of these are common for authentic, handmade terracotta tiles.
